+
+
+//
+// Define a global that we can use to shut down the NT timer thread when
+// the timer is canceled.
+//
+BOOLEAN                 mCancelTimerThread = FALSE;
+
+//
+// The notification function to call on every timer interrupt
+//
+EMU_SET_TIMER_CALLBACK  *mTimerNotifyFunction = NULL;
+
+//
+// The thread handle for this driver
+//
+HANDLE                  mNtMainThreadHandle;
+
+//
+// The timer value from the last timer interrupt
+//
+UINT32                  mNtLastTick;
+
+//
+// Critical section used to update varibles shared between the main thread and
+// the timer interrupt thread.
+//
+CRITICAL_SECTION        mNtCriticalSection;
+
+//
+// Worker Functions
+//
+UINT                    mMMTimerThreadID = 0;
+
+volatile BOOLEAN        mInterruptEnabled = FALSE;
+
+VOID
+CALLBACK
+MMTimerThread (
+  UINT  wTimerID,
+  UINT  msg,
+  DWORD dwUser,
+  DWORD dw1,
+  DWORD dw2
+)
+{
+  UINT32            CurrentTick;
+  UINT32            Delta;
+
+  if (!mCancelTimerThread) {
+
+    //
+    // Suspend the main thread until we are done.
+    // Enter the critical section before suspending
+    // and leave the critical section after resuming
+    // to avoid deadlock between main and timer thread.
+    //
+    EnterCriticalSection (&mNtCriticalSection);
+    SuspendThread (mNtMainThreadHandle);
+
+    //
+    // If the timer thread is being canceled, then bail immediately.
+    // We check again here because there's a small window of time from when
+    // this thread was kicked off and when we suspended the main thread above.
+    //
+    if (mCancelTimerThread) {
+      ResumeThread (mNtMainThreadHandle);
+      LeaveCriticalSection (&mNtCriticalSection);
+      timeKillEvent (wTimerID);
+      mMMTimerThreadID = 0;
+      return;
+    }
+
+    while (!mInterruptEnabled) {
+      //
+      //  Resume the main thread
+      //
+      ResumeThread (mNtMainThreadHandle);
+      LeaveCriticalSection (&mNtCriticalSection);
+
+      //
+      //  Wait for interrupts to be enabled.
+      //
+      while (!mInterruptEnabled) {
+        Sleep (1);
+      }
+
+      //
+      //  Suspend the main thread until we are done
+      //
+      EnterCriticalSection (&mNtCriticalSection);
+      SuspendThread (mNtMainThreadHandle);
+    }
+
+    //
+    //  Get the current system tick
+    //
+    CurrentTick = GetTickCount ();
+    Delta = CurrentTick - mNtLastTick;
+    mNtLastTick = CurrentTick;
+
+    //
+    //  If delay was more then 1 second, ignore it (probably debugging case)
+    //
+    if (Delta < 1000) {
+
+      //
+      // Only invoke the callback function if a Non-NULL handler has been
+      // registered. Assume all other handlers are legal.
+      //
+      if (mTimerNotifyFunction != NULL) {
+        mTimerNotifyFunction (Delta);
+      }
+    }
+
+    //
+    //  Resume the main thread
+    //
+    ResumeThread (mNtMainThreadHandle);
+    LeaveCriticalSection (&mNtCriticalSection);
+  } else {
+    timeKillEvent (wTimerID);
+    mMMTimerThreadID = 0;
+  }
+
+}
